What Are Bed Bugs?

Bed bugs are small, reddish-brown insects that feed on the blood of humans and animals. Despite their size (about the size of an apple seed), they are resilient pests capable of hiding in cracks, crevices, mattresses, and furniture. Bed bugs are most active at night and can travel quickly from one location to another, making infestations a growing concern.

Signs of a Bed Bug Infestation

It can be challenging to spot bed bugs due to their size and nocturnal habits. However, common signs include:

  • Bites: Small, red, itchy welts often appearing in clusters or lines.
  • Blood Stains: Tiny blood spots on sheets, pillowcases, or mattresses.
  • Fecal Marks: Dark or rust-colored spots on bedding, mattresses, or walls.
  • Eggs and Shells: Tiny, pale eggs or shed exoskeletons in mattress seams or furniture.
  • Musty Odor: A sweet, musty smell in heavily infested areas.

Our Bed Bug Control Process

Step 1: Inspection and Identification

We begin with a detailed inspection of your home, including mattresses, box springs, furniture, and cracks or crevices where bed bugs might hide. Our trained technicians use specialized tools to ensure no hiding spot is overlooked.

Step 2: Customized Treatment Plan

Once the infestation is confirmed, we develop a personalized treatment plan based on the severity of the problem. Our methods include:

  • Heat Treatments: Raising room temperatures to levels lethal to bed bugs, effectively killing them at all life stages.
  • Chemical Treatments: EPA-approved insecticides applied to targeted areas for thorough eradication.
  • Steam Treatments: High-temperature steam to eliminate bed bugs in mattresses, furniture, and hard-to-reach places.
  • Encasements: Using bed bug-proof mattress and box spring encasements to prevent re-infestation.

Step 3: Treatment Application

Our skilled technicians carefully apply treatments, ensuring every corner of your home is addressed. We prioritize safety by using methods that are effective yet safe for families and pets.

Step 4: Monitoring and Follow-Up

After the initial treatment, we monitor the effectiveness of the process and perform follow-up visits if needed. We also provide tips to help you avoid future infestations.

Tips to Prevent Bed Bug Infestations

While bed bugs can happen to anyone, taking precautions can help reduce your risk:

  • Inspect second-hand furniture before bringing it into your home.
  • Use protective covers on mattresses and box springs.
  • Regularly vacuum carpets, furniture, and mattresses.
  • Check for bed bugs when traveling, especially in hotel rooms.
  • Wash bedding and clothing in hot water and dry on high heat.
